Inmate Escapes from Frankfort Career and Development Center
Frankfort, KY – Kenneth Cribb, an inmate at the Frankfort Career and Development Center escaped from a work detail on Friday, October 13, 2006. He was reported missing at 8:44 a.m. Cribb was serving a 20-year sentence for convictions out of Whitley County for criminal attempt to murder, criminal mischief 1st degree, assault 3rd degree, possession of firearm by convicted felon and unlawful transaction with a minor 2nd degree. He would have been eligible for parole in June of 2008. Crib is a 46-year-old white male, 6’2”, 175 lbs with gray hair and hazel eyes. The Kentucky State Police have been contacted and anyone with any information regarding Cribb is asked to contact KSP at (502) 227-2221.
